Demographics :

We recruit and retain quality employees who are reflective of our students and the community we serve, in addition to providing all personnel with equity and diversity training.

The District is a proud Chicanx / Latinx, and Hispanic-Serving Institution, Asian American and Native American Pacific Islander-Serving Institution, and Minority Serving Institution, serving over 66,446 students based on the 2022-2023 academic year.

The student population is as follows :

  • by Race / Ethnicity 57.02% Latinx, 9.33% White, 19.36% Asian, 2.82% Filipino, 0.23% Pacific Islander, 3.33% Black / African American, 0.28% American Indian / Alaskan Native, 2.02% two or more races and 5.61% unknown;
  • by Gender 54.35% Female, 42.91% Male, 0.47% Non-Binary, 2.27% unspecified;
  • and by Age 46.03% ages 19 or younger, 20.37% ages 20-24, 9.05% ages 25-29, 5.64% ages 30-34, 3.87% ages 35-39, 5.04% ages 40-49, 10% ages 50 and older.

The current employee population is as follows :

  • by Race / Ethnicity 37% Latinx, 29% White, 15% Asian, 6% Black / African American, 1% Middle Eastern or North African, 1%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ander, 2% Two or More Races, 9% unknown;
  • by Gender 56.47% Female, 42.19% Male, 1.34% Non-Binary;
  • and by Age 3.94% ages 20-29, 19.46% ages 30-39, 30.21% ages 40-49, 46.39% ages 50 and older.

    Minimum Qualifications :

    A. The minimum of one of the following awarded / conferred from a regionally accredited institution :

  • Masters or Master of Fine Arts in drama / theater arts / performance; OR
  • Bachelors or Bachelor of Fine Arts in drama / theater arts / performance AND
  • Masters in comparative literature, English, communication studies, speech, literature or humanities; OR

  • The equivalent (must request an equivalency review in the application), OR
  • California Community College credential, Valid for Life (no longer issued), authorizing service as an instructor in the appropriate discipline; refer to Ed Code 87355 (If meeting qualifications with this credential, a copy of the valid lifetime credential must be submitted with the application.);
  • AND

    B. Commitment to the community college goals / objectives of providing quality programs and services for students with diverse abilities and interests; personal qualities to work effectively and sensitively in a multicultural environment; awareness and commitment to the special needs of non-traditional students. Preferred Qualifications :

  • Communicate effectively to students orally and in writing.
  • An MFA in Acting, or related discipline
  • Professional Experience in Acting for Theater / Live Audiences
  • Experience Teaching within a diverse and inclusive classroom environment
  • Willingness / Experience in developing curriculum related to student areas of interest (Musical Theater, Stage Combat, Generative / Experimental Theater, etc)
  • Essential Duties & Responsibilities :

    Teach courses in the Theater Arts discipline, including but not limited to, Acting, History of Theater, Script Analysis, Introduction to Theater Arts, Directing, Playwriting, Musical Theater, and Childrens Theater.
